Sectional Anatomy

The study of the anatomy of the body in sections, used primarily in imaging technology.

2
New cards

Coronal Plane

A vertical plane that divides the body into anterior (front) and posterior (back) sections.

3
New cards

Axial Plane

A horizontal plane that divides the body into superior (upper) and inferior (lower) sections.

4
New cards

Sagittal Plane

A vertical plane that divides the body into left and right sections.
